Also known as St. Helena Island
Where: Beaufort County, South Carolina (32.2° N, 80.8° W: paleocoordinates 32.2° N, 80.8° W)
• coordinate based on nearby landmark
• small collection-level geographic resolution
When: Late/Upper Pleistocene (0.1 - 0.0 Ma)
Environment/lithology: terrestrial; sandstone
Size class: macrofossils
• "over half the skeleton" is present
Collected by C. U. Shephard, Jr. in 1869
Collection methods: quarrying,
• Amherst College collection
•found "nearly at low water. One thigh bone projected for say two feet out of the sand and had been used by boatmen to tie their boats to"
Primary reference: F. B. Loomis. 1918. An unusual mastodon. American Journal of Science 45:438-444 [J. Alroy/J. Alroy/J. Alroy]more details
